怎么把文件输出到excel

怎么把文件输出到excel

将文件输出到Excel的方法有多种,常见的包括:使用Python编程语言及其库、利用Excel自带功能如导入功能、借助第三方工具等。 其中,使用Python编程语言及其库如Pandas和Openpyxl是最灵活和强大的方法。下面将详细介绍如何使用Python将文件输出到Excel。

一、使用Python将文件输出到Excel

1. 使用Pandas库

Pandas是一个强大的数据处理和分析库,广泛应用于数据科学和数据工程领域。通过Pandas库可以非常方便地将文件(如CSV、JSON等)读取并输出到Excel格式。

import pandas as pd

读取CSV文件

df = pd.read_csv('file.csv')

将数据输出到Excel文件

df.to_excel('output.xlsx', index=False)

详细描述

上面的代码首先导入了Pandas库,然后使用pd.read_csv()方法读取CSV文件,最后使用df.to_excel()方法将数据输出到Excel文件。需要注意的是,to_excel方法中的参数index=False表示不输出DataFrame的索引。

2. 使用Openpyxl库

Openpyxl是一个用于读写Excel 2010 xlsx/xlsm/xltx/xltm文件的Python库。它可以更加灵活地操作Excel文件,包括创建、修改和读取Excel文件。

from openpyxl import Workbook

创建一个新的工作簿

wb = Workbook()

ws = wb.active

写入数据

ws['A1'] = 'Hello'

ws['B1'] = 'World'

保存文件

wb.save('output.xlsx')

详细描述

上述代码使用Openpyxl库创建了一个新的Excel工作簿,并在第一个工作表中写入了一些数据,最后保存为output.xlsx文件。Openpyxl库提供了更多的功能,如样式设置、图表生成等,适合需要对Excel文件进行复杂操作的场景。

二、利用Excel自带功能

1. 导入功能

Excel自带的导入功能可以轻松将各种文件格式导入到Excel中。

详细描述

  • 导入CSV文件:在Excel中打开一个新工作簿,点击“数据”选项卡,选择“从文本/CSV”,然后选择需要导入的CSV文件,按照提示完成导入。
  • 导入JSON文件:打开Excel,点击“数据”选项卡,选择“获取数据”->“自其他来源”->“自JSON”,选择需要导入的JSON文件,按照提示完成导入。

2. 复制粘贴

对于简单的数据处理,直接复制粘贴也是一种快速有效的方法。

详细描述

  • 从文本文件复制粘贴:打开文本文件(如.txt),选择并复制所需数据,打开Excel,在需要的位置粘贴数据。可以使用“文本分列”功能对数据进行进一步处理。

三、借助第三方工具

1. 使用ETL工具

ETL(Extract, Transform, Load)工具可以帮助将数据从各种源提取、转换并加载到目标文件或数据库中。常见的ETL工具包括Talend、Pentaho等。

详细描述

  • Talend:Talend是一款开源的ETL工具,支持多种数据源和目标,包括Excel。可以通过其图形化界面设计数据流,将文件输出到Excel。
  • Pentaho:Pentaho是一款强大的数据集成工具,支持数据抽取、转换和加载操作。使用其Kettle组件可以方便地将文件输出到Excel。

2. 使用在线转换工具

在线转换工具可以快速将文件转换为Excel格式,适合小规模的数据处理。

详细描述

  • Convertio:Convertio是一个支持多种文件格式转换的在线工具,可以将CSV、JSON、XML等格式的文件转换为Excel。
  • Zamzar:Zamzar也是一个多功能文件转换工具,支持将各种文件格式转换为Excel。

四、总结

无论是使用编程语言、利用Excel自带功能,还是借助第三方工具,将文件输出到Excel都有多种方法可供选择。选择合适的方法取决于数据量、复杂度和具体需求。对于简单的任务,可以直接使用Excel自带的导入功能或在线转换工具;对于复杂的数据处理,Python编程语言及其库如Pandas和Openpyxl是更为强大和灵活的选择;而对于企业级的数据集成需求,ETL工具则是最佳选择。

通过以上介绍,相信您已经了解了多种将文件输出到Excel的方法,并能根据具体需求选择最适合的方法进行操作。

相关问答FAQs:

1. 如何将文件输出到Excel?
您可以使用以下步骤将文件输出到Excel:

  • 首先,打开您要输出到Excel的文件。
  • 在文件中选择要输出的数据或内容。
  • 然后,将鼠标悬停在选定数据上方的工具栏上,并选择“复制”选项。
  • 最后,打开Excel文件,将鼠标悬停在您要将数据粘贴到的单元格上,并选择“粘贴”选项。

2. 如何将文件中的数据导出到Excel表格中?
要将文件中的数据导出到Excel表格中,您可以按照以下步骤进行操作:

  • 首先,打开您的文件并选择要导出的数据。
  • 然后,点击文件菜单中的“导出”选项。
  • 接下来,选择导出为Excel文件的选项,并指定要保存的位置和文件名。
  • 最后,点击“导出”按钮,您的数据将被导出到Excel表格中。

3. 如何使用特定软件将文件输出为Excel格式?
如果您使用特定的软件来处理文件,并且想将其输出为Excel格式,您可以按照以下步骤进行操作:

  • 首先,打开您的文件,并在软件界面中选择要输出的数据。
  • 然后,找到软件菜单中的“导出”或“保存为”选项。
  • 接下来,选择导出为Excel格式的选项,并指定要保存的位置和文件名。
  • 最后,点击“导出”或“保存”按钮,您的文件将被输出为Excel格式并保存在指定位置。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4697591

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部